Why 2025 Is a Fertile Ground for New Token Theses

  • Liquidity is returning. Spot ether ETFs received regulatory approval in 2024, further institutionalizing crypto allocations and broadening the investor base, a shift that tends to cascade into higher-beta assets during risk-on periods. See coverage in SEC-focused outlets and industry press for context, such as the report that the U.S. SEC approved spot ether ETFs in May 2024, enabling subsequent launches later that year (reference: SEC approvals reported by major crypto media at the time; for background, see CoinDesk’s coverage: SEC Approves Spot Ether ETFs).
  • Scaling is here. Ethereum’s data availability upgrade via EIP-4844 (proto-danksharding) drastically reduced L2 data costs and unlocked new application surfaces for consumer crypto and microtransactions. Read more on the roadmap at ethereum.org.
  • UX is improving. Account abstraction (ERC-4337) is making smart accounts mainstream, enabling gas sponsorships, session keys, and bundled transactions that onboard the next wave of users without compromising non-custodial guarantees. Learn more from the EIP itself: ERC-4337.
  • Infrastructure narratives are leading. Real-world resource networks (DePIN) and restaking-based security markets (AVSs) are capturing attention thanks to tangible utility and revenue prospects. For DePIN context, see a16z crypto’s industry overview: The State of DePIN. For restaking and AVS design space, see the EigenLayer documentation and ecosystem resources.

These structural shifts shape the backdrop for assessing tokens with credible paths to sustainable demand and defensible cash flows.

2) Sustainable Token Design and Demand Sinks

A credible token model should show:

  • Token as a unit of account for network fees, staking collateral for service providers, or governance weight for protocol upgrades.
  • Net demand over time via fee capture, buyback/burns, or mandatory staking for node roles.
  • Emission discipline (declining inflation, capped supply, or adaptive issuance tied to revenue).

For a primer on token economics and what to watch, see this overview: What Is Tokenomics?.

Checklist:

  • Is there real fee flow denominated in the token?
  • Are emissions subsidizing early growth while trending toward neutrality?
  • Do node operators or validators need to stake BEE to offer services?

4) Security and Decentralization Posture

Security is a moat, not a checkbox:

  • Audits and formal verification where applicable.
  • Permissionless validator sets or providers with transparent staking requirements and slashing mechanics.
  • Minimal reliance on upgrade multisigs; clear timelines for progressive decentralization.

For engineering patterns and pitfalls, see OpenZeppelin’s guidelines: Secure Smart Contract Development.

5) Sound Liquidity Architecture and Bridge Risk Management

If BEE is multichain or rollup-native, bridge design matters:

  • Prefer canonical or audited bridges with robust fault assumptions.
  • Avoid fragmented liquidity across dozens of non-canonical bridges that are hard to monitor.

Context: Cross-chain bridges have historically been prime targets for exploits; see historical analysis by Chainalysis: Cross-Chain Bridge Hacks.

6) Compliance Surface and Regulatory Readiness

Jurisdictions are clarifying digital asset frameworks:

  • In the EU, MiCA rules began phasing in during 2024/2025, particularly for stablecoins and service providers; a compliant posture eases exchange listings and institutional integrations. See ESMA’s dedicated MiCA page: MiCA Implementation.
  • In the U.S., the Financial Innovation and Technology for the 21st Century Act (FIT21) advanced in Congress, signaling a path toward clearer market structure rules. Track the bill on Congress.gov (H.R.4763).

Tokens designed for real utility and transparent governance fare better as rules tighten.

How to Diligence BEE Before You Size the Position

  • Read the docs and verify the code. Confirm the chain(s), contract addresses, and upgrade paths via official repos. Use block explorers and verified contracts where possible.
  • Validate the business model. Map protocol revenue to token value accrual (fees, staking yields after costs, or burns).
  • Compare promises to shipped product. Roadmaps are not cash flows—prioritize delivered integrations and paying users.
  • Stress-test liquidity. Simulate entries/exits across venues; monitor pool depth, fees, and potential MEV impacts.
  • Monitor security posture. Review audits, bug bounty programs, and incident response playbooks.
  • Create an exit plan. Determine invalidation points (e.g., delayed mainnet, missed integrations, or tokenomics changes).

Risk Matrix

  • Smart contract risk: Bugs in core contracts, upgrade proxies, or reward distribution.
  • Economic risk: Unsustainable emissions or liquidity mining that masks weak demand.
  • Governance risk: Centralized control of parameters or treasuries.
  • Execution risk: Overpromising on integrations that require third parties to deliver.
  • Market risk: Correlated drawdowns as liquidity rotates across narratives and L2 ecosystems.
